On Thu, 2004-01-29 at 16:50, Igor_ wrote: > PROBLEM DESCRIPTION: > The > only problem we have with > this approach is "blackening" of any CADENCE window when we click on > gnome panel. Hmm - I wonder if what you are describing is different from what I tend to call "color map flashing" - the behavior that occurs on machines with 8 bit color video cards when X has to assign to the application its own color map, with different colors than those used in the general shared color map. The application can, quite often, appear to be 'darkening'. The reality in the situation to which I refer is that as you focus between differing apps, the entire screen is displayed with different color map palettes. I began seeing an increase in this sort of thing as netscape began using more and more colors.
